The following items were among Birch Villages' capital expenditures during the year that ended December 31:
Equipment for village tax collector's office | $40,000 |
Vehicles for village electric utility | $60,000 |
What amounts should have been recorded in the General Fund and Enterprise Fund for the increase in equipment during the year ended December 31, assuming the electric utility is accounted for in an Enterprise Fund?
A. General Fund: $0; Enterprise Fund: $0
B. General Fund: $0; Enterprise Fund: $60,000
C. General Fund: $40,000; Enterprise Fund: $60,000
D. General Fund: $100,000; Enterprise Fund: $0
